Summary

The name Ioannis originates from the Hebrew Yochanan, meaning 'God is gracious.' It evolved through Greek as Ioannis and later through Latin as Johannes to the English John. It is associated with biblical figures and has been popular since early Christianity. The name signifies grace and has variants such as Giannis and Yannis. It is well-regarded in modern Greece, symbolizing tradition and kindness.

Etymology

The name Ioannis is derived from the Hebrew name Yochanan, meaning 'God is gracious.' It has been used in various forms across cultures and languages, particularly in Christian contexts.

Biblical Background

The name Ioannis is the Greek form of John, which is significant in the Bible as it refers to several important figures, including John the Baptist and John the Apostle.

📜

Historical Usage

The name Ioannis has been popular in Greek-speaking regions since the early Christian period and has maintained a continuous presence throughout history.

Famous People

Ioannis Kapodistrias - a prominent Greek statesman, Ioannis Varvakis - a famous Greek shipowner and benefactor, Ioannis Metaxas - a notable Greek politician and general
